Is alexandrite a real gemstone?
Yes. Natural alexandrite is a genuine gemstone and one of the rarest in the world. It is a variety of the mineral chrysoberyl that shifts color between green in daylight and violet or red under incandescent light. Most alexandrite sold commercially is synthetic.
-
Does this alexandrite actually change color?
Yes. Natural alexandrite exhibits a genuine color-change phenomenon. The degree of shift varies by stone. Because each stone is natural, the exact color range is unique to your piece.

The Meaning Behind the Stone
One of the rarest gemstones in the world, natural alexandrite is known for its extraordinary color-change phenomenon, a quality that has made it a symbol of duality, transformation, and good fortune across cultures. It is the traditional birthstone for June and the stone of those who embrace change as a form of strength.
